About The Position

This position offers an exciting opportunity for a Graduate Nurse (GN) to join the Labor and Delivery team at Fairbanks Memorial Hospital in Alaska. The role involves assisting direct caregivers in all aspects of patient care, from assessment to evaluation, and participating in interdisciplinary planning. The hospital is a non-profit, Joint Commission-accredited facility with a strong patient-to-nurse ratio and a culture of Shared Leadership. Fairbanks offers a unique lifestyle with abundant outdoor activities and amenities, including no state income or sales tax.

Requirements

  • Must have graduated from an accredited nursing program and be eligible for NCLEX-RN licensure exam.
  • Must complete the NCLEX-RN exam within twelve weeks of start date.
  • Must have successfully passed NCLEX-RN exam within six month provisional window.
  • Must possess a valid current or temporary Alaska RN license.
  • Requires the knowledge and skills normally demonstrated by an Associate’s degree in nursing.
  • BLS certification is required.
  • Requires creative thinking, prioritizing, and flexible problem solving skills.
  • Requires the ability to communicate clearly in both verbal and written forms.
  • Requires a minimum 2 year commitment.
